How to Use an RSS Feed


In order to subscribe to an Open Society Foundations RSS feed, you first need an RSS reader to read the feed. There are many versions, some of which are desktop-based and others that can be accessed using a web browser. Internet Explorer 7, Firefox, and Safari all include features that allow you to subscribe to RSS feeds. We list a few below.

Once you've set up your RSS reader, you are ready to subscribe to our feeds. Your browser or RSS reader should automatically detect our feeds and display an icon — — that will make it easy to download them. You can also click on the links to subscribe directly.
